16 Open Source Home Automation Platforms To Use In 2020
Homebridge is a modern and lightweight NodeJS server that emulates the iOS HomeKit API. This means that, once installed on your low-power machine (including the Raspberry Pi), it can service the same requests you are used to on your iOS device via Siri. The original contributors to this project thought of this because of the countless devices that couldn't connect to the...
